在Node.js中使用键值连接多个JSON对象可以通过使用lodash
库中的merge
函数来实现。merge
函数可以将多个JSON对象合并为一个对象,并且可以根据键值进行连接。
以下是一个示例代码:
const _ = require('lodash');
const obj1 = {
name: 'John',
age: 30
};
const obj2 = {
occupation: 'Developer',
language: 'JavaScript'
};
const mergedObj = _.merge(obj1, obj2);
console.log(mergedObj);
输出结果为:
{
name: 'John',
age: 30,
occupation: 'Developer',
language: 'JavaScript'
}
在上述示例中,我们使用merge
函数将obj1
和obj2
合并为一个新的对象mergedObj
。merge
函数会将两个对象的属性合并到一个新的对象中,如果有相同的键值,则后面的对象的属性值会覆盖前面的对象的属性值。
在Node.js中,使用键值连接多个JSON对象可以方便地将不同的数据源进行整合,例如从数据库中获取的数据和从API接口中获取的数据可以通过键值连接来合并为一个完整的数据对象。
推荐的腾讯云相关产品:腾讯云云数据库(TencentDB),提供了多种数据库产品,包括关系型数据库、NoSQL数据库等,可以满足不同场景下的数据存储需求。产品介绍链接地址:腾讯云云数据库
注意:本答案仅供参考,具体的实现方式和推荐的产品可能会根据实际需求和情况有所不同。
领取专属 10元无门槛券
手把手带您无忧上云